Name: Desulfoplanes Watanabe et al. 2015
Etymology: De.sul.fo.plan’es. L. prep. de, off; L. neut. n. sulfur, sulfur (S); Gr. masc. n. planês, a wanderer, roamer; N.L. masc. n. Desulfoplanes, a sulfate-reducing wanderer, pertaining to a motile sulfate reducer
Gender: masculine (stem: Desulfoplanet-)
Type species: Desulfoplanes formicivorans Watanabe et al. 2015
